Abstract
Indirect adaptive control of control-affine nonlinear systems is considered in this study. A new methodology is proposed, which makes use of multiple identification models. Switching criterion between the models and enhancement of the transient response with the use of multiple models are discussed. The study is verified by simulation of a nonlinear system
